Maurice Milliere
Maurice Milliere was a prolific French illustrator, artist, designer and etcher. He was a key figure in what has come to be regarded as Boudoir Art and an influence on later artists like Louis Icart. He was born in Normandy, France, Milliere began his art education in Le Havre but was soon transferred to the École des Beaux-Arts and Arts Décoratifs in Paris, where he was a classmate of Toulouse-Lautrec and Raoul Dufy.
